## Artifact signing for the FX rounder

Quick heads-up for reviewers: the Pellgrove conversion service now does banker's rounding to kill those half-cent drift bugs we kept seeing in nightly reconciliation. The fix lives in the rate-apply step, not the ledger, so diffs there are expected. Any build touching currency math must ship as a signed artifact so downstream teams can trust the rounding behavior. Use the signing key below when publishing.

deploy key for kagap-yafof: bky6_m3fsDq

Telemetry payload compression runbook (Pennygale pipeline): before each release, confirm the compressor sidecar is pinned to the approved zstd level (currently 6) — higher levels have caused CPU throttling on the Harrowfield edge nodes. Validate by sampling ten payloads from the staging stream and checking that compressed size stays under 48 KB. If payloads exceed the limit, the schema team must trim fields before the cut proceeds. To pull staging samples, call the Pennygale inspection endpoint and authenticate with the key below.

app token of bahaf-tajeg = zpat23_SjjsllwiLmXbtS65veZaV47

Capacity note for the Fennelgrid sidecar review. Aggregation window widened to cut emit rate; per-pod memory ceiling holds at current cardinality (~12k series). CPU flat. Risk: buffer overflow if a tenant spikes labels — mitigated by the drop policy. No node-pool changes needed for the Caldermoor cluster this quarter. Review the flush and buffer settings before merge. Constants under review are below.

limits module of yafop-hahag:
QUOTAS = {
    "tamwyn": 652,
    "prawyn": 731,
}

## Environments — Chirpwell deploy bot

Chirpwell is our little chat bot that posts deploy status into team channels. It runs in three environments: sandbox (fake deploys only), staging (mirrors real pipelines, posts to a private channel), and prod. For the security review: the bot has read-only pipeline access everywhere, and prod is the only environment that can post to shared channels. Token rotation happens monthly. The production instance runs with the following configuration.

deployment values, taweg-bajop:
[fenvan]
port = 5672
team = holmir
host = fenvan.orvexio.example
region = lower-1
access_code = ac_b98bc6
timeout_ms = 1500